MyEclipse2014在其POM文件的一处提示出错如下:
Plugin execution not covered by lifecycle configuration: org.apache.maven.plugins:maven-compiler-plugin:3.1:compile (execution: default-compile, phase: compile)
这表示m2e在其执行maven的生命周期管理时没有定义该插件,所以提示出错,其实m2e对此是提供了扩展机制的,我们可以通过如下操作来消除这个出错提示:
1. 进入Window—>Preferences—>Maven4MyEclipse配置,进入Lifecycle Mapping设置项,如下图:
从上图可以看出m2e管理maven生命周期的文件名是lifecycle-mapping-metadata.xml,以及该文件的存放路径
2. 下一步我们就要去相应路径修改lifecycle-mapping-metadata.xml文件,但会发现这个文件在上图中提示的位置并不存在,那么此时就可以到eclipse的安装目录下的plugins下的org.eclipse.m2e.lifecyclemapping.defaults_xxxxxx.jar文件中找到该文件(如下图):
通过解压软件可以发现lifecycle-mapping-metadata.xml文件的确在jar包中,把它从jar包中解压出来并放置到前图所示的路径下
3. 打开lifecycle-mapping-metadata.xml文件,把未识别的插件在文件中加入即可:
<pluginExecution>
<pluginExecutionFilter>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-compiler-plugin</artifactId>
<goals>
<goal>compiler</goal>
<goal>testCompiler</goal>
<goal>copy-compiler</goal>
</goals>
<versionRange>[3.6.1,)</versionRange>
</pluginExecutionFilter>
<action>
<ignore />
</action>
</pluginExecution>
4.修改完成后,需在m2e配置处把“Update Maven projects on startup”选项勾上,并重启eclipse即可消除出错示。
- 大小: 11.7 KB
- 大小: 37.9 KB
分享到:
相关推荐
maven-for-scala插件,用来解决eclipse/myeclipse scala...Plugin execution not covered by lifecycle configuration: net.alchim31.maven:scala-maven-plugin:3.2.0:compile (execution: default, phase: compile)
myeclipse 8.5 plugin 插件 安装方法 介绍了在MyEclipse8.5下怎么样安装插件
MyEclipse10plugin.用户公用目录下的配置文件.rar
做了很大的优化,破解MyEclipse10plugin.part1
优化破解版 MyEclipse10plugin.part2.rar
myeclipse错误处理集合,让你逐步精通 myeclipse错误处理
myeclipse的maven插件,直接安装,不用下载。。。大家多多支持
MyEclipse+hibernate错误:Could not get list of suggested identity strategies from database解决
MyEclipse解决到处war错误,打开MyEclipse的安装目录,然后找到这个jar文件:com.genuitec.eclipse.export.wizard_9.0.0.me201211011550.jar,用下载后的文件替换,替换后,最好将jar文件改成.txt文件结尾,然后重启...
一般MySQL连接不上,可能有两大原因:1、MyEclipse配置错误 2、MySQL配置不当。 一、我们一般的连接步骤如下: 1、在MyEclipse中连接MySQL数据库:依次点击window–>show view–>other–>MyEclipse Database–>DB ...
第一步:将插件放到一个文件夹下; 第二步:将项目导入到myeclipse9/以上版本,...MyEclipse-9.0M1\configuration\org.eclipse.equinox.simpleconfigurator下的bundles.info文件里; 第四步:重新启动myeclipse即可。
myEclipse6.5解决启动错误或中途崩溃自动关闭
Myeclipse 的SVN插件,便于程序员对源码版本的控制,可以轻松的管理你的源码
myeclipse10.5 myeclipse10.6 myeclipse10.7.1 导出war包报完整性检查错误问题
maven插件 for myeclipse 亲测可用
Use:java -jar instPlug4MyEclipse.jar PluginPath eclipsePath 如:java -jar instPlug4MyEclipse.jar D:/ADT-18.0.0 D:/myeclipse10 重启myeclipse安装成功。 Eclipse(MyEclipse)离线插件安装工具 Version:0.1.1...
MyEclipse9插件的安装方法不是想象的那么容易,但是有了这个类你将可以轻松安装
1、你的eclipse上有可能安装了jboss公司的hibernate tools plugin for eclipse,这些插件与myEclipse发生冲突,解决方法是删除这些插件。 2、你在没有卸载以前myEclipse版本的情况下安装了新的myEclipse版本,解决...
MyEclipse
MyEclipse 7.0 出现灾难性错误